Am new to this board. I got a question which disturbs me. Am a first time pregnant and i am in my 17th week and still dont feel any movements of my baby. Is it normal not to feel the baby moving by the end of the 17th week?
My tummy is growing fast but i dont feel any movements inside.

| You should feel your baby move by about 20 weeks. If you can't feel him/her moving by then, you should talk to your doctor about it. |

Perrrrfectly Normal! Dont worry a bit - most women only start feeling around the 18wk according to the stats.
Its quite a hard little thing to pick if your a first time Mum but with each week it will get stronger and stronger  |
